grade 3 cliff hanger

QuestionAnswer
being tied to a person or a rock with a rope for safety belay
a trip down into or from something, such as a mountain descent
a set of straps that can attach to a safety rope harness
to come down a cliff by sliding down a rope rappel
made a slow and difficult journey on foot trekked
a large or important church Cathedral
a book used to record the names of guests at a hotel, club, or school registration book
rock-climbing tools that are jammed into cracks in the rock and used to anchor ropes climbing nuts
metal rings used by rock climbers to attach ropes to themselves or to climbing nuts carabiners
areas of rocks, snow, or earth that fell down a mountain avalanches
a tall column or pillar shaft
a shelf of rock ledge
a long narrow chain of mountains ridge
making firm, steady bracing
falling suddenly and quickly plunging
short splashing noises splats
moved slowly and carefully eased
a large, empty space void
something to hold on to for support handhold
knew something before it happened foresaw
straight up and down vertical
to climb without being attached to anything free climb
an act of thinking hard, staying focused concentration
